Algeria Coach Madjer Blast – Nigerian Team Is Full Of Bench Warmers Bar Arsenal Iwobi


Newly appointed coach of Algeria national team Rabah Madjer has hit out at the Nigerian team who his team will be facing on Friday in a dead rubber World Cup 2018 Qualifiers tie.
Speaking to the press in Algeria, Madjer who was not in charge of the team when they suffered a 3-1 loss to Nigeria in the reverse tie played in Uyo said the Nigerian team has many players who don’t get to play for their European clubs..
” I have studied the Nigerian team, apart from Iwobi, every other player is mostly a substitute for their team in Europe , but that doesn’t mean they will not be at the level to face us”, Madjer said.
” The game against Nigeria is not a friendly match for me, to me it’s the first game of the qualifiers for the 2018 African Cup of Nations in Cameroon”.

Rohr – I Will Introduce Six New Players In The Starting Line Up Against Algeria


Coach of the Super Eagles of Nigeria Gernot Rohr has revealed that he could introduce as many as six new players in his starting line up when they take on Algeria on Friday.
Nigeria are up against Algeria in a dead rubber World Cup 2018 Qualifiers tie on Friday, and according to Rohr he would use the game to test some fringe players in his team.
” All the games are important, it’s right we have already qualified for the World Cup, so the result is not the most important, the most important in this game will be to play a good game”, Rohr said in an interview posted on the official twitter handle of the Super Eagles.
” We always play to make good games and good results , but it’s an opportunity for us to see some players who didn’t play so much during the qualifiers because we have our team, and now we have six injuries, so it will be at least six changes”.

Iwobi : I Almost Cried When I Scored The Winning Goal Against Zambia


Arsenal winger Alex Iwobi has admitted that he almost wept when he scored one of the most important goals of his young career in a World Cup qualifier against Zambia on October 7.
It took only seven minutes for the Hale End Academy graduate to make his mark after coming off the bench, as he swept the ball past Chipolopolo goalkeeper Kennedy Mweene after he was teed up by Abdullahi Shehu.
''It’s so hard to describe, you know what I mean. When I actually scored the moment was crazy, I remember running off celebrating,'' Iwobi told arsenal.com.
''I almost cried, I actually almost cried to see how the fans were reacting, to see my mum and dad in the stands, it was just an amazing feeling. ''
The Gunners number seventeen added : ''When I scored the goal, because the security are very strict the fans were trying to come on the pitch as I scored, but the security guards stopped them and after the fans they played trumpets and banged drums, so the players were just dancing, it was just crazy.''
Iwobi will make his thirteenth appearance for the Super Eagles if he features against Algeria on Friday, November 10.
